When our thoughts look real to us, we live in a world of illusion.
When our thoughts look like just thoughts, we wake up to a space of possibility.
One is not necessarily better than the other. It is in the space of possibility that the illusions of our thinking are experienced – as one of many possibilities.
When we like what we are experiencing, it might not occur to us to notice. But when we do not like our experiences, it helps to know that they are but one possibility of experience.
There are always more ways of thinking and being available to us beyond the one we are experiencing. And the ones we end up choosing in each moment shape the unique story of our lives.
There is no right way of thinking or being. There are only possibilities to be experienced for a short period of time. There is no better way of thinking or being – only the ones we tend to prefer at different times.
You do not need to imagine living in a world where everything is just a possibility, and nothing needs condemning. Where you are always free to make choices about what you’d like to think, and how you’d like to be, that best suits your temperament at all points of time. And more importantly, where you are always free to simply be, irrespective of whatever thinking you happen to experience.
You just need to notice that you are already living in that world right now.
